Blepharoplasty surgery in Delhi is done for many reasons, however, in our practice it is mostly done for cosmetic improvement of the eye area of face.
With normal ageing process, the skin and muscles lose strength over time. The skin is thinnest around the eyes, and hence, is the first to show these signs. This excess skin in eyelids results in increased creases around the eyes, and also droopy eyelids. In such cases, we perform eyelid lift surgery. Also, as the muscle starts to lose strength, it is unable to hold the fat in place. This fat, in turn, starts to collect under the eyes causing UNDER EYE BAGS or Puffy eyes. The procedure to remove these is called Lower Blepharoplasty, Eyebag surgery, under eye surgery or lower eyelid surgery.
Blepharoplasty is done to improve the look of the eyes in all of these cases. In case of droopy eyelids, excessive skin is removed, and for under eye bags, the fat deposits are removed. There is no visible scar (Click here to view the scar), as the incision is given at the lashline. Also, if needed, excessive skin can be removed. It is also done for double eyelid creation or Asian Blepharoplasty.

Is Blepharoplasty truly scarless?
Blepharoplasty is not exactly scarless, but the scars are almost invisible. In lower lid blepharoplasty, the incision is placed inside the lower eyelid, and hence there is absolutely no scar on the outside.In upper eyelid blepharoplasty, the incision is placed on the natural fold of the upper eyelid. This, after healing, shrinks to such a thin line, which coincides completely with your natural fold, that it is technically invisible. You can see how the scar will look like post-surgery:

What is Asian Blepharoplasty, Sliver Blepharoplasty, or Double Eyelid Surgery?
Asian Blepharoplasty, which is commonly known as Double Eyelid Creation surgery or Sliver Blepharoplasty is the procedure used to create a crease or fold in the upper eyelids, in people where it is not present naturally. This is usually seen in certain Asian communities, and hence the name. In this procedure, a tiny sliver of tissue is removed from the upper eyelids, which upon healing, gives rise to the eyelid fold or double eyelids.
What cannot be treated with upper eyelid blepharoplasty?
Sunken upper eyelid – needs fat grafting / Fillers
Ptosis – Required Ptosis correction surgery
Brow Ptosis – requires Brow lift
Crow’s feet
What are the alternative options for upper eyelid surgery or upper blepharoplasty?
You can opt for procedures like peels and fractional CO2 laser treatments for tightening of the skin of the upper lid. These options work best for younger people with minimal laxity of skin.
How is the recovery in eyelid surgery?
In majority of the patients who are undergoing just upper lid surgery, recovery is very smooth. Although, there is a significant amount of swelling and bruising in most of the patients, however, it usually resolves within 5-7 days’ time. You can head back to work after the swelling subsides, in case, you have a sedentary work.

Is the lower lid surgery painful?
NO- The surgery will be done under Local anesthesia which will make the lid numb and thus you won’t feel any pain. The eye is covered with a shield during the procedure, and therefore, no damage happens to the eyeball / vision of the patient.
For apprehensive patients, we can administer some light sedation which will make you go into twilight sleep.
What is the Duration of lower eyelid surgery
Usually takes about 40 mins to 1 hr to complete lower eyelid blepharoplasty.
What is the usual age for lower eyelid blepharoplasty in Delhi
Usually, above 40 years of age. However, even younger patients with under eyebags can be treated with transconjunctival blepharoplasty

What are the risks and complications associated with Eyelid surgery, and how to minimise them?
Blepharoplasty in Delhi: Understanding the Risks and Complications
Blepharoplasty, or eyelid surgery, is a procedure that can improve the appearance of drooping eyelids or bags under the eyes. While it can be an effective way to rejuvenate your appearance, it’s important to be aware of the potential risks and complications associated with the procedure.
Common Risks and Complications
- Dry Eyes: Blepharoplasty can sometimes lead to dry eyes, as the surgery may affect the tear ducts.
- Asymmetrical Results: There may be slight asymmetries in the results, which can be difficult to achieve perfect symmetry in both eyes.
- Infection: The surgical site is susceptible to infection, especially if proper care is not followed.
- Bleeding: Slight bleeding can occur during or after the procedure.
- Scarring: Scars may be visible, especially in the crease of the eyelid.
- Double Vision: Double vision can occur in rare cases, but it is usually temporary.
